ABSTRACT:
The invention features a method of generating a three-dimensional topography of a property of an object, by (a) generating digital data points at a plurality of sample points on the surface of the object, each digital data point including a property value and a position value corresponding to a particular sample point; (b) assigning each digital data point to one of a plurality of discrete compartments based on the position value of the data point, each compartment corresponding to a unique location on the object and containing zero, one, or more digital data points; (c) determining a quality value for each of the compartments based on the quality of the digital data points assigned to that compartment, and assigning to each compartment a code representing the quality value; (d) generating and assigning new digital data points to each compartment having a code indicating an unacceptable quality value, the new data points corresponding to sample points on the object at a location corresponding to the compartment; (e) determining a new quality value for each compartment to which new digital data points have been assigned and assigning to each compartment a code representing the new quality value; (f) repeating step (d) until all compartments are assigned a code indicating an acceptable quality value;
and (g) generating from the digital data points and new digital data points a three-dimensional topography representing the property of the object.
